The Pompidou Centre is one of the most daring modern art museums in France and perhaps even in the world. The centre was the brainchild of French President Georges Pompidou who wanted to create a unique cultural institution in France, the end result was a cutting edge museum dedicated to contemporary art. Where brush strokes are side by side with key strokes; the Pompidou Centre explores the length and breadth of contemporary art by showcasing visual art, music, cinematography and literature.
The ideology behind the construction of the centre was to bring art and culture into the realm of the common man and the bold architectural design of the building was envisioned as a way of appealing to the minds of the public. Though the building is located in one of Paris’s oldest and most historic locales with buildings such as the Notre Dome Cathedral in the neighborhood, the architecture clashes violently with the surroundings, which makes its presence even more pronounced. Known as a construction that turned the course of modern architecture upside down, from afar the building’s steel and concrete, brightly coloured tubes and transparent glass gives it the impression of being an unfinished construction. The area in front of the museum is known as the Place Georges Pompidou, this is an area dedicated to street performers such as jugglers, musicians and mimes. During spring time open air carnivals featuring bands, singers, theatre groups and even skate boarding competitions are hosted here. The Pompidou Centre boasts of an extensive collection of modern art works including those by Picasso, Braque, Max Ernst, Magritte, Chagall, Matisse, Delaunay, Kandinsky and Klee. The public library inside the Pompidou centre is very popular among the locals and occupies the first three floors of the building. The library has a collection of over 45,000 contemporary works of literature by authors all over the world and also has copies of over 2,500 periodical magazines. Located in an interesting part of Paris, it is possible to spend the entire day exploring the Pompidou Centre and adjoining areas such as Le Marais, Les Halles. There are a range of great portable music players on the market but the most popular by far is the one that was launched by Apple Inc on the 23rd of October 2001. I can hardly believe that it was that long ago that Apple first launched the best selling digital music player of all time. We have come a long way since the first devices that when you see them now are large in comparison to the tiny nano models that first became available in September 2005.
Technology has moved on since and the first generation touch screen version launched in 2007 with the top of the range model with 32gb of storage. This marked the evolution of the music player. The touch as it was named when officially released allows you to browse the internet using Apple’s browser Safari and send and receive e-mails and even watch video from YouTube on the move. The name came from a freelance copywriter who was contacted by Apple to plan how to introduce the product to the public. After seeing the proto type Vinnie the freelance copywriter thought of the film 2001 a space odyssey and of the phrase “open the pod bay door Hal“. The iPod was born. The name was researched and it was found that it had been trademarked in July 2000 and had been used for internet kiosks. Closely following the launch of the touch came the iPhone which was very similar in looks but packed with features that you would expect to find on a phone like a 2.0 mega pixel camera, internet access, email and more. The iPhone has not see the uptake in the UK that was expected as there are a range of mobile phones that have music playing features that normally come free on a pay monthly package. This could all change with the launch of a 3G version that will allow faster internet speeds and will be subsidised with a monthly contract so that the 8GB version comes in at one hundred pounds with the basic contract and free on a higher monthly contract so will this kill off everyone’s favourite music player? The Sony Ericsson C902 Red is a candy bar shape phone. The handset is backed with the top-of-the-line multimedia features such as FM radio, music player, digital camera and lots more. The users can perform and manage the functions on the wide 2 inches screen.
The Sony Ericsson C902 Red is a 3G phone which is enclosed with image and media focused features. High-end features keep the users entertained for couple of hours. The candy bar shaped casing comes with no fancy opening systems. The mid-sized phone can be easily operated with a single hand. The slender and slim casing measures 11mm in thickness, 108 mm in height and 49 mm in width. This mid-sized casing is ideal for carrying purposes. It comes with a stunning 2 inches colour display which unfurls up to 262 K colours on a QVGA screen with a high resolution of 240 x 320 pixels. This stylish 3G phone comes with easy to access touch sensitive keys. The touch keys are used to control and select advanced camera features. Therefore, it can be said that these touch keys make the using of camera function a pleasure. An integrated accelerometer feature helps the users to rotate their handset as well as the screen according to their needs. This Cyber-shot phone is made to capture great pictures. A built-in 5 mega pixels camera feature is the primary feature on this image focused 3G handset. The highly used camera features fulfill the need of dedicated digital camera. The camera features are used to capture a precise & clear picture at all times. The duller or poor lighting conditions do not stop the users from capturing still or video photography. Some of the highly used imaging features are auto-focus, face focus, digital zoom, camera touch keys, BestPic, Image Stabliser and red eye reduction. This 3G enabled phone supports advanced video recording capabilities such as video streaming, video calling, video player and video stablizer. This Sony Ericsson C902 displays colourful album art on its wide screen. It allows the users to view and enjoy the album, while listening or hearing it. With the support of Bluetooth stereo A2DP, the users can possess a wireless connection between their handset and headset. An integrated FM radio with RDS support provides the users with on screen text information. The displayed information is relevant to the song playing on the radio or news information. The built-in media player is endowed with useful music features including MegaBass frequency for enhancing feature, a TrackID music recognition feature and a PlayNow for music downloading. The Nokia 6500 Classic has reaffirmed its leadership in delivering the benefits of 3G, and high-end multimedia to a niche segment of users. The sophisticated design of this classic model is also a definite attraction – especially in the mid-range market. It is designed with large keys and user-friendly interface. Therefore, it can be said that the 6500 classic has been created keeping in mind the maximum usability.
With the Nokia 6500 classic, the manufacturer delivers a compelling blend of design and technology. The anodised aluminum casing makes the 6500 classic the most stylish handset with a slim profile. The dimensions of device are 109.8mm in height, 45mm in width and 9.5mm in thickness and a weight of 94 grams. A wide colour screen and easy-to-use keypad enhances the design of the phone. The multimedia options of the phone are some of the best features in music as well as imaging. The owners can personalize the mobile telephony experience by using stereo headsets. The fun filled music experience comes with a built-in media player that provides high quality sound. As matter of fact, the music player sports a wide range of highly interesting features such as TrackID, PlayNow, MegaBass, etc. The megapixel digital camera is situated at the back. The advanced imaging features ensure that there is never a dull moment or blurred image. With the help of the multimedia messaging options, the owners can share the captured images and music files with their friends. The built-in 3G capabilities allow the users to experience the mobile telephony features with a difference. Unlike other non-3G phones, the nokia 6500 classic from Nokia allows the users to access high speed broadband Internet, video streaming, and multitasking, without any trouble. On the 6500 classic, the users can store the multimedia content worth 1GB. The users are able to enjoy uninterrupted conversation over this handset, as it supports quad-band technology that covers GSM 850, 900, 1800, 1900 and WCDMA.
